Extend the Foreclosure Pause of VA-guaranteed Loans

Woodstock Institute joins fellow advocates in urging the Department of Veterans Affairs to “extend the foreclosure pause of VA-guaranteed loans from May 31, 2024 to December 31, 2024. The extension is needed to ensure that Veterans have a full opportunity to access the newly-released VA Servicing Purchase (VASP) program, which VA has indicated will take months for servicers to fully implement. Homeowners who could benefit from VASP should not lose their homes to foreclosure before they have a chance to access the program.”
